Cost of Living in Edmonton

Edmonton is known for its relatively affordable cost of living compared to other major Canadian cities. The average rental prices for a one-bedroom apartment in Edmonton are significantly lower than Ontario, making it an attractive option for those looking for affordable housing options. Additionally, other expenses such as transportation, food, and healthcare tend to be more affordable in Edmonton compared to Ontario.

Cost of Living in Ontario

Ontario, on the other hand, is home to major cities like Toronto, which is known for its high cost of living. The housing prices in Ontario, particularly in Toronto and the Greater Toronto Area (GTA), tend to be much higher compared to Edmonton. Transportation costs, especially in larger cities like Toronto, can also be higher due to congestion and higher fuel prices. Food and grocery costs may also be slightly higher in Ontario compared to Edmonton. Healthcare costs, however, are relatively similar in both provinces.

Comparison of Housing Costs

In terms of housing costs, Edmonton generally offers more affordable options compared to Ontario. The average rental prices and home prices in Edmonton are lower than cities like Toronto and Ottawa. However, it's worth noting that housing costs can vary depending on the location within each province.

Comparison of Transportation Costs

Transportation costs in Edmonton are generally lower compared to Ontario, especially in cities like Toronto where public transportation fares can be quite high. Edmonton has a well-connected transit system with affordable fares, making it easier and more cost-effective to commute within the city.

Comparison of Food and Grocery Costs

When it comes to food and grocery costs, Edmonton tends to be more affordable than Ontario. While prices can vary depending on specific products and stores, overall, Edmonton offers a more budget-friendly shopping experience compared to Ontario.

Comparison of Healthcare Costs

Both Edmonton and Ontario have similar healthcare systems, and the costs associated with healthcare are relatively similar in both provinces. However, it's worth noting that healthcare costs can vary depending on factors such as medical services required and individual insurance coverage.
